So, let’s get started. For this eBook “glimpse”, I will provide you with the details on how to start from scratch and build a website. For entertainment purposes, I am going to make my sample website one that is about animals. You can choose any niche you are interested in – maybe parenting, sports, medicine – really anything. The first step is to narrow down your niche and to find three to four, longtail keyword phrases that are highly searched on the internet but have very low competition levels. This keyword research should be done first, before you even buy a domain or set up hosting. It is important to find a keyword rich domain as this will be favored by Google, Yahoo and Bing.

For the first step, let’s find a bunch of keywords that have high search volume. Using a keyword tool called SEObook (which can be found here), select the icon that says “keyword tool, and you’ll be able to type in long tail phrases and find one that has a high search volume. It is important to find long tail phrases – say three to four words a piece, with search volume of, at least, 100 per day. If you choose more broad keywords, with high search volume, they will be too competitive for this project.

In may example, I am doing a search for “monkeys for sale”. Right off the bat, I see the following four, long tail keyword phrases with search volume as follows:
capuchin monkeys for sale – 2772
squirrel monkeys for sale – 1522
baby pet monkeys for sale – 1499
monkeys for sale – 1420

These figures represent the average number of people who are searching in the major search engines using these targeted phrases. So, I’m on my way to picking a domain and website – looks like I’ll be focusing on some aspect of moneys for sale. In Lesson Two, we will discuss how to determine which of these phrases, with high search volume, also has very low competition on the web – a key to successful online marketing.
